Wessex, Edward the Elder (899-924), Penny, Horizontal Type, Winchester, Beornhere, + EADVVEARD REX, small cross pattée, rev. BEORN | +++ | ERE MO, row of cross pattée between, 1.60g [24.69grns], 2h (SCBI -; EMC -; BM 314; North 649; S.1087), very scarce, no listings on the EMC for Winchester for this type, deeply toned, an impressive specimen, good very fine

Provenance

Keith Bayford, by private treaty [with his ticket]
